I have distressed the edges by tearing and inking them with Vintage photo and Walnut stain distress inks, and here and there I have painted them with picket fence crackle paint, which has also been sponged with vintage photo, for a real shabby chic look.
This stunning image is from Mo's Digital Pencil, "Michael". Isn't it so adorable. I have coloured the image with copics and then distressed the edges the same as the papers and added some crackle paint around the edges too. I wanted the card to look like it has been made with lots of little treasures that have been found.
The sentiment has been created on a piece of grungeboard. The alphabet stickers came with a pencil tin of my Son's (I pinched the letters he didn't need for his name - naughty Mummy LOL). I have inked them with vintage photo, stuck them to the grungeboard and then painted the crackle paint around them so that some of it is on the stickers, and of course distressed with vintage photo around the edges.
The top right corner has been covered in crackle paint and then distressed with ink and I have added a gorgeous pearl brad from the Hobby House.
The beautiful blue flower is by petaloo from my local shop, Running with Scissors, and the roses are from Wild Orchid crafts, all have been sprayed with glimmer mist. The butterflies have been punched from Magnolia's silent night music sheet paper with MS butterfly punch. I have sponged the edges with distress ink and added some tiny pearls in the centres. The small roses are mounted onto gold spacers from the Hobby House.
Hopefully in this photo you can see my "kraft" paper. I have used some, honest, it's just got a little hidden under all the shabby chicness LOL. I tore up a brown corrugated cup holder to form a strip, painted the corners with yet more crackle paint and layered some gorgeous fine lace over the top. I think you can just about see some of the non painted "kraft" paper underneath the lace LOL!! I also added a couple of strands of some straw like ribbon that was wrapped around a candle I bought recently.
